    Application closing date: 30 June 2024

    Qualifications

    Masters or Honours in:

    • Data Science
    • Computer Science
    • Statistics
    • Applied Mathematics
    • Actuarial Science
    • Engineering (Chemical, Electrical, Mechatronics)
    • Informatics
    • Quantitative Risk Management

    Honours qualification to be completed by 31 December 2024.

    Additional Information

    Minimum requirements:

    • South African Citizen
    • Should you have work experience, it should not exceed 24 months 
    • Full academic transcripts to be submitted with application for undergraduate and postgraduate studies.
